Bulgaria’s ๐Ÿ‡ง๐Ÿ‡ฌ Memorable Win

In the icy grip of February, with temperatures hovering between -1ยฐC and 3ยฐC, football fans were treated to an exhilarating display of talent and determination at The Nations Cup XII. The tournament, held yesterday, witnessed Bulgaria clinching their first-ever title, following dramatic penalty shoot-outs in both the semi-final against Italy and the final against Romania. This landmark victory has etched Bulgaria’s name in the annals of football history.
